Process Engineer
On-siteKinston, North Carolina, United States
Job Summary
Optimize industrial processes by creating integrated manufacturing dossiers, producing detailed optimized processes with STV calculations, and determining process efficiency through Value Added Time assessments. Develop line balancing strategies, analyze manufacturing systems during major modifications, and minimize travelling work by documenting and resolving outstanding tasks. Implement continuous improvement proposals to enhance work station efficiency and identify reduction opportunities for non-value-added production activities. Collaborate with program customers, front-line managers, and ME specialists to deliver optimized solutions while ensuring safety, cost, and quality criteria are met. Assist in training new team members and respond to technical queries across various departments.
